In this episode, we examine the rise of streaming platforms and the disruption they have caused in the traditional television industry, with a focus on Netflix. We'll trace the evolution of Netflix, from its beginnings as a mail-order DVD rental service to its transformation into a global streaming powerhouse. We'll explore the factors that have contributed to Netflix's success, including its data-driven content strategy, original programming, and innovative distribution model. We'll also discuss the challenges Netflix faces, such as increasing competition from other streaming services, content licensing issues, and concerns over its environmental impact. Finally, we'll consider the broader implications of the streaming revolution, including its impact on viewing habits, the entertainment industry, and the future of television. Hosted on Acast.
